Marks & Spencer

Marks and Spencer, a retail company, sells clothing, food, and home accessories. The company operates stores in the United Kingdom and internationally. Its range of products includes womenswear children's clothes, menswear and Lingerie. It also offers sandwiches, cakes and brownies. It also offers drinks, wine and spirits, and gift baskets. M&S Energy and M&S Bank offer financial services.

The company is known for putting quality first, and was one of the first companies to offer an unconditional return policy on all purchases. It was later replaced by a 90-day warranty, but it remains a distinct brand among its competitors. Additionally, it provides free delivery on all orders. The company offers a wide range of clothing lines, including Per Una and Autograph. It also collaborates with designers such as Patricia Fields and George Davies.

In the early 20th century, Marks and Spencer established a policy of selling only British-made products. It also began to establish long-term relationships, and also developed a St Michael brand, in honor of the founder Michael Marks. In the 1930s, it concentrated on two areas that included food and clothing.

By 1955 fashion had rebelled against the regulations on utility clothing and the New Look dress was based upon Christian Dior's Corolle collection. Marks and Spencer adopted this trend by giving suppliers guidelines on the latest fashions and designing coordinated lingerie.

As a result, M&S became a leader in the design of ready-to wear clothes that fit well and are affordable. The company was also the first to pioneer the use of many different fabrics. Customers could select from a wide range of colors and styles, Online Store uk Cheapest and the company quickly became a market leader in the UK clothing industry.

Misguided

Missguided has a low customer service rating, with numerous customers expressing displeasure about their experience. The company also does not have a telephone number, so it is difficult to contact them. It does offer email and live chat support. Some customers have reported getting responses within an hours, which is fast for the industry.

The company was founded by maverick entrepreneurial Nitin Passi in Manchester, where it still has its headquarters. Within a short time it grew to become one of Britain's largest online fashion retailers and competed with big players like ASOS and Boohoo. Nicole Scherzinger and Sofia Richie were also fans of the brand. However the popularity of the brand waned during the lockdown of the pandemic when budgets of households were squeezed and demand for fast-fashion fell.

In December, the firm filed for administration and was bought by Mike Ashley's Frasers Group, which owns House of Fraser and Sports Direct. The new owner intends to keep the Missguided brand and will continue to manage it as a distinct brand. The move comes at a time that the fashion industry is facing the slowing of sales, rising costs for energy and a shift towards sustainable and ethical clothing.
